About This Book
Mr. Bundy isn’t just any principal—he’s a frog! When a magical mishap turns him green and slimy, school becomes a wild adventure full of leapfrogs in the gym and unexpected splashy surprises. Can the students save their froggy principal before he hops away for good?
Quick Assessment
This humorous early chapter book follows the students of PS 88 as they cope with their principal, Mr. Bundy, who is magically transformed into a frog. Suitable for ages 5-8, it blends magic and school life with lighthearted fun, encouraging emerging readers with accessible language and playful storytelling. There is no content likely to concern parents, making it a delightful, imaginative read.
